    Description

    The Department of Defense, specifically the Naval Research Laboratory, intends to award a sole source purchase order for the renewal of an OrCAD License to EMA Design Automotive of Rochester, New York. This procurement is classified under the NAICS code 541519, which pertains to Other Computer Related Services, and is essential for maintaining the laboratory's software capabilities. The purchase will be executed using Simplified Acquisition Procedures, with a threshold not exceeding $250,000, and interested parties have one calendar day from the publication of this notice to express their interest and capability.
